13+ Admissions Manager
Contract type: Permanent
Hours of work: Full time, 52 weeks
Salary: Dependent on experience
Closing date: 27th January 2026
Location: Buckingham, Buckinghamshire
Job Overview
Stowe School is seeking an Admissions Manager with responsibility for 13+ pupil recruitment and the customer journey, from initial enquiry to the pupil joining the School.
As a brand ambassador for Stowe School this is a vital role in ensuring an exceptional admissions process is implemented, creating a warm and welcoming environment from the first initial contact through each touch point of the admissions journey and beyond.
You will be professional, people focussed and enjoy working in a fast paced environment. You will have a pro active approach to attracting prospective families to the School whilst building long term inclusive relationships. Attention to detail is essential as is a desire to meet and exceed targets whilst providing a high level of customer service at all times.
To find out more details about the role and how to apply, click here.
Stowe School is committed to safeguarding and promoting the welfare of children. Applicants must be willing to undergo child protection screening appropriate to the post, including checks with past employers, the Disclosure and Barring Service and an online background check with our 3rd party provider SP-Index.
We reserve the right to close the vacancy early should we receive suitable applications